The Peel board serves more than 153,000 kindergarten to grade 12 students in 244 schools throughout Brampton, Caledon and Mississauga.
The Peel board has been welcoming international students for more than nine years. Recently, the Peel Academy for International Students was established to enhance the level of support available to international students studying in the Greater Toronto Area.

The Regional Municipality of Peel (also known as Peel Region) is a regional municipality in Southern Ontario, Canada. It consists of three municipalities to the west and northwest of Toronto: the cities of Brampton and Mississauga, and the town of Caledon. The entire region is part of the Greater Toronto Area and the inner ring of the Golden Horseshoe. With a population of over 1,320,000, Peel Region is the second-largest municipality in Ontario after Toronto. The Peel District School Board is one of Canada’s largest publicly funded school boards. Located just outside of Toronto, Peel Region is one of the safest and most multicultural cities in the world. Many international tourist attractions are within one, two, or three hours’ drive – CN Tower, Niagara Falls, Norman Bethune’s birthplace, Algonquin Park (7,725 square kilometres of magnificent nature reserve), to name just a few.
The Peel District School Board has Homestay arrangements in place for students who require a place to live while in Canada. Canada’s Newcomer Services, Homestay Select Inc. and Superior International Education Development (SIED) are three possible Homestay organizations in Mississauga.
Each organization promises to provide appealing accommodations and caring hospitality in Canada, from a host family who shares in the student’s interests and educational goals. This means students arrive in Canada to a supportive home environment, and are offered assistance at every stage of their visit in Canada. All of our accommodations are located in appealing, safe neighborhoods accessible to school via public transportation.
